A Simple & Speedy Pan-Fried Flavorful Asparagus Dish
Craving a nutritious side dish? This fantastic sauteed asparagus recipe is incredibly straightforward to make! Just snap the tough ends off your asparagus, then heat a small of canola oil in a skillet over high heat. Add the asparagus and stir for about 5-7 minutes, or until bright green and gently browned. Flavor with seasoning and ground pepper – it’s a beautiful way to enjoy this spring vegetable!
